It is with great sadness that the family of Gladys Louise Woody Stanley of Acworth, Ga (better known as "Nan") announces her passing after an extended illness, on Monday, April 29, 2019, at her home at the age of 84 years young surrounded by her family. Nan was born May 26, 1934, and grew up in Barberton, Ohio where she played volleyball in school. She loved to swim in Lake Anna and hang out with her best friend Noma. Growing up Gladys would spend some summers with her grandmother, Laura, in Ga where she meets the love of her life Curtis. Gladys and Curtis married December 20, 1952, and had a wonderful son and a beautiful daughter together.
Nan was known to be a very loving mother and doted over her grandchildren and great-grandchildren. She was a member of The Big Creek Baptist Church. She was very active in the church where her husband, Curtis, was a deacon. She was an avid reader and gardener and loved to decorate her house. She will be remembered for her generosity and for being witty. She was the best biscuit maker in the world. She was very intelligent, strong and had a special love for her family and conservative political views.
